Duties

What you will do:
  • Be responsible for the operation of their assigned center in accordance with all LLE Group policies and applicable licensing standards 
  • Be accountable for the overall financial health of the school to include budget maintenance, billing and tuition collection, fundraising, dealing with outside vendors, and maintaining inventory of all supplies
  • Oversee the upkeep of the school grounds and facility
  • Ensure implementation of training, to enhance the skill and professionalism of the staff within their assigned school
  • Be responsible for ensuring that the staff maintain an adequate number of training hours as required by the licensing and accreditation standards
  • Be responsible for the development and implementation of targeted marketing plans and the overall implementation of the Marketing Department’s Enrollment Building program
  • Be responsible for the evaluation of programs, including individual classroom observations, develops plans to facilitate program improvement and the implementation of these plans in coordination with District Director and others
  • Attend meetings as necessary to perform duties and aid in business and organizational development as directed by the District Director or his/her supervisors
  • Be responsible for hiring, orienting, training, counseling and terminating staff

Requirements

What you have:
  • Early childhood professional credential such as a CDA, CCP or AAS in early childhood education; Bachelor’s Degree Preferred
  • Knowledge of applicable laws, rules and regulations relevant to the operations of a childcare facility
  • Knowledge of the principles and practices of supervision and training, and instruction methods, programs, philosophies and theories relevant to the operation to the operation of a childcare facility
  • Excellent verbal, written and listening skills and the ability to communicate to a wide-ranging audience including those with varied educational levels and backgrounds
  • Strong interpersonal skills and a willingness to work as part of a team
  • Ten or more hours of management training
  • At least one year of experience in a supervisory role
  • Successful completion of the Virginia Pre-Service Training for Child Care Staff
  • Successful background check and VA licensing standards required
